Dr. Martin Luther King Jr's life and legacy was deeply connected to his Christian faith, he often used biblical principles to reflect on the inhumane treatment human beings experience in situations connected to racism and discriminatory treatment based upon racial hierarchies.

Join us for a Womanist Service in honor of Rev. Martin Luther King, Jr. This synchronous service will be delivered online. Attendees are invited to bring a candle to their viewing of this service.

Featured Speaker: Chaplain Quanita Hailey, FP '14
